A PUNTER scooped £178,000 for a £10 soccer bet — which only came good with a last-minute penalty.
The man had been on the verge of tearing up his betting slip as Charlton led Liverpool 2-1 after 89 minutes.
But in the 90th minute Liverpool were awarded a penalty which Harry Kewell slotted home. The goal was worth £178,000 to the punter — who would have won NOTHING from the accumulator bet if Kewell missed.
The gambler, from Sawston, Cambs, had correctly predicted eight results
for the last day of the Premiership on Sunday — including Manchester United’s shock home defeat to West Ham.
The accumulator came in at odds of 17,841-1.
The punter, who asked not to be named, said: “I had looked at the betting coupon and had a gut feeling about the matches. My first reaction was that there was no way all eight would come in.
“But like a true punter, I couldn’t change my mind, so I had a tenner on it.”
A Corals’ spokesman said it was one of the firm’s biggest payouts. “It’s cost us a fortune — but we have to congratulate him.”
